Q1. What is Information Technology (IT)?
Q2. What are the Components of Information Technology?
Ans (1 & 2)
Information technology is the technology that uses computing with high-speed communication links to spread information from one place to another. The interconnection of Computers enables people to send and receive information. The communication links are also used to communicate with different people in the world.
The world has become a global village due to information technology. It means that people living in the world known one another as if they are living in a village. It has become possible due to fast communication links. Information can be transferred from one place to another place easily and quickly.
Information palys an important role in every field of life. Information can be used to improve the standard of life. It can also be used for solving different problems. For example, if a person has the latest information about the medical field, he can use this information to cure different diseases.
Information technology has enabled different types of institutions and organizations to be a part of digital convergence. The digital convergence means that various industries have merged electronically to exchange information. This merging is very important in the modern world. The information can be transferred in various forms such as text, photos, audio and video etc.
Components of Information Technology:
Three components of information technology are as follows:
Computers:
Electronic system that can be instructed to accept, process, store and present data and information.
Communication Networks:
It is an interconnection of different locations through a medium that allows people to send and receive information. Communication Networks allows people and businesses to interact. It includes hardware, programs and information. Information technology has become revolutionary the use of Communication Networks. Information can be transferred from one place to another easily and quickly.
Know-how:
Know-how is the capability to do something properly. Information technology know-how includes the familiarity with the tools of information technology including the Internet as well as the skills needed to use these tools. It also includes the understanding of using IT (Information Technology) for problem-solving and creating opportunities.
